NTF 代理概述
Junos OS 通过 gRPC 和 UDP 公开遥测数据,作为 Junos 遥测接口 (JTI) 的一部分。将 JTI 数据流式传输到现有遥测和分析基础结构的一种方法需要管理外部实体以将数据转换为兼容格式。从 Junos OS 18.4R1 版开始,网络遥测框架 (NTF) 代理功能提供了一个现成的解决方案,允许您配置和自定义将 JTI 数据传输到哪个端点(例如 IPFIX 和 Kafka),以及数据编码的格式(例如 AVRO、JSON 和 MessagePack)。
NTF 代理使用输出插件将 JTI 数据转换为适合特定端点的格式。NTF 代理使用用户定义的传感器信息订阅 JTI 数据。接收数据时,NTF 代理使用输出插件以端点所需的格式对数据进行编码,然后将转换后的数据导出到端点(请参阅 图 1)。NTF 代理可以使用 Junos OS CLI 或 NETCONF 进行配置。
图 1:NTF 代理体系结构
